Interesting, when Oscar-winning composer AR Rahman got picked up for Ram Charan’s Peddi movie, not many have a positive opinion. However, the success of the song Chikiri Chikiri, composed by Mozart of Madras, suggests that he will be approached by many more Telugu stars now.

Strong buzz in Tollywood circles suggests that AR Rahman is being considered for Megastar Chiranjeevi’s next film, tentatively referred to as #Mega158, which will be directed by KS Bobby of Waltair Veerayya fame. If this collaboration materialises, it would mark the first-ever musical partnership between Chiranjeevi and AR Rahman.

Back then, had Megastar agreed to S Shankar’s Oke Okkadu story in the 90s, surely AR Rahman’s songs would have got a chance to enter Chiranjeevi’s filmography. However, when Shankar’s Gentleman movie was remade in Hindi, they used Rahman’s original tunes in Hindi without any change, and it wouldn’t be considered a collaboration as such.

With Ram Charan’s Chikiri turning into a massive chartbuster, crossing 200 million views on YouTube across all languages, the song’s pan-India appeal and Rahman’s ability to blend rooted sounds with global sensibilities worked out big time. Let’s see if the Chiru-Rahman combo gets official or not.
